The Kasprowy Wierch Ski Lift Hasn't Been Having a Good Run. It Barely Started Before It Broke Down.

The chairlift in the Goryczkowa Valley was not operational last season due to a lack of snow in the Tatra Mountains. This winter, skiers enjoyed it for only a week. During a breakdown on Thursday, tourists were stranded on the lift. When will the chairlift be operational again? PKL has announced the date. Thursday's outage is not the only problem on the famous ski slope.

In the Goryczkowa Valley on Kasprowy Wierch, a cable car engine malfunction occurred around noon, according to "Tygodnik Podhalański." RMF FM reports that repairs could take up to several days.
